Royal Van der Leun supplied the complete electrical installation for the innovative Damen Combi Freighter 3850, built for Rederij Bernd Sibum. Designed for efficient and sustainable cargo transport, this next-generation hybrid vessel combines wind-assisted propulsion with an advanced hybrid power system to significantly reduce fuel consumption and CO₂ emissions.

A key feature of the vessel is its ability to operate fully electrically on battery power, making it possible to sail emission-free during specific operations. This is enabled by the seamless integration of the Battery Energy Storage System (ESS), PTO/PTI system and Royal Van der Leun's own automation platform.

Our proprietary automation system intelligently controls the complete energy and propulsion system, continuously optimizing the interaction between the diesel engine, batteries, PTO/PTI system and onboard power distribution for maximum efficiency, reliability and operational flexibility.

Engineering, manufacturing and commissioning were carried out by our specialists in China, supported by our hybrid propulsion experts in the Netherlands. This project once again demonstrates the strength of our international collaboration and expertise in hybrid marine solutions.

Royal Van der Leun will deliver: 

  • Complete electrical engineering
  • Main Switchboard (MSB)
  • Emergency Switchboard (ESB)
  • Distribution boards
  • Motor Control Centres (MCC)
  • Power Management System (PMS)
  • Alarm Monitoring & Control System (AMS)
  • Royal Van der Leun Automation System
  • Hybrid propulsion automation system
  • Battery Energy Storage System (ESS) integration
  • PTO/PTI system integration and automation
  • Intelligent energy and power management
  • Fully electric battery-powered sailing capability
  • Complete electrical power distribution
  • Onboard cabling and electrical installation
  • Interior and exterior lighting
  • Navigation lighting
  • Commissioning, testing and system integration
